BIOWARFARE
by Mitchel Cohen
With the U.S. government poised to once again bomb Iraq, the administration
and media are orchestrating the barely repressed hysteria and manipulating
the American public into a chorus for retribution and war.

It doesn't matter that Iraq has categorically denied any connection to the
attacks on the World Trade Center and to the Anthrax scare, and has, indeed,
denounced them.

Before the US bombardment began ten years ago under the auspices of George
H.W. Bush, Sr., Iraq -- along with Israel -- had the most sophisticated
health care system in western Asia and the Middle East. And it was free for
all Iraqis. It also had modern sanitation and drinking water systems.

The U.S. bombardment took care of that. Hundreds of thousands of Iraqi
people were murdered outright by the U.S. bombardment in 1991. A million
more were killed by U.S. destruction of Iraq's drinking water and hospitals,
combined with the sanctions against that beleaguered people. Children
continue to die from malnutrition and curable ailments that go untreated due
to the U.S./U.N. embargo and sanctions. Whatever one thinks of Saddam
Hussein (or George Bush, or Bill Clinton for that matter), when did the
people of Iraq become our enemy?

George W. Bush is following in his father's and in former President
Clinton's footsteps; both repeatedly declared the need to bomb Iraq again
and again. Why? Back in 1998 Clinton and Gore said it was to force Iraq's
President, Saddam Hussein, to allow the U.S. to be represented on U.N. teams
inspecting Iraq's alleged chemical and biological weapons facilities. The
Canadian and Dutch inspectors were permitted by Iraq, but this was not
considered good enough by the U.S. It had to be U.S. inspectors -- Iraq
claimed they were working with the CIA, and so objected. Whitewashed in all
the orchestrated hysteria and mumbo jumbo is that it was the U.S. and its
allies that provided Iraq with nerve gas to begin with, along with all sorts
of chemical and biological agents.

Saddam Hussein -- who had been installed as President of Iraq in a CIA
orchestrated coup -- obtained the nerve gas on the world market (the leading
suppliers were the U.S., France, England, Germany and Russia). Even as he
condemned the threatened use of chemical and biological weapons by Saddam
Hussein, U.S. President George Bush knew full well the extent of arsenal,
for it was Bush himself, in his former capacity as head of the CIA (and
later as Vice President and President), who had approved shipments of
material needed to make biological and chemical weapons to Iraq.

Bush approved shipping to Iraq toxic varieties of E.coli and Salmonella
bacteria, and agents causing anthrax, gas gangrene and brucellosis.(1)

In the course of restructuring the production and control of world oil, the
Gulf war provided the the U.S. military with the opportunity to test new
depleted uranium weapons, gas vaccines, and biological warfare medications
in the field, on its own soldiers. Inoculations -- some genetically
engineered and completely experimental -- were mandatory and generally done
without the consent and often against the will of the soldiers. As it turns
out, these inoculations are now viewed by independent researchers as
cofactors in the development of Gulf War Syndrome, mysterious ailments
afflicting hundreds of thousands of American veterans of the Gulf. And, in
February, 1998, the U.S. began shipping large containers of untested
genetically engineered anthrax vaccine to Israel to thwart the expected use
of biological agents the U.S. had supplied to Iraq. What kind of devious
mass experiment was being set up here?

The Bush administration also signed 700 licenses worth $1.2 billion for so
called "dual use" technology to Iraq. As exposed by the Simon Wiesenthal
Center in California and House of Representatives Banking Committee Chair
Henry Gonzalez (D, Texas), hundreds of U.S. and European corporations such
as Hewlett Packard, Honeywell and others provided Iraq with such "dual use"
technology as computers for weapons guidance, fuel air explosives, imaging
circuitry for missile warheads, vaccum pumps and bellows for nuclear power
plants, and live cultures for bacteriological research. These were sent
directly to the Iraqi military.(2)

In early February, 1998, the Russian government warned the U.S. not to bomb
Iraq. To discredit Russia, word suddenly "leaked" that three years earlier
(and the US government conveniently "just" discovered it! What a
coincidence!) Russia sent "dual purpose" technology to Iraq which U.S.
officials claimed could be used for bacteriological warfare. In actuality,
this "dangerous" equipment sold by Russia was nothing more than a 5,000
liter vat for fermenting yeast. Could such a product be used for making,
say, anthrax? Yes, although not the sophisticated "military grade? variety.
So could any pressure cooker or, for that matter, any bathtub. It could also
be used for making beer, and, more likely, antibiotics, which Iraq was
desperate to obtain after a decade of war with Iran in which 1 million
people on both sides were killed. Meanwhile, the press has yet to question
why the U.S. had exported to Iraq far more ominous biological agents and
military technology, with Reagan's and Bush's approval. What did the press,
let alone Bush and Reagan, expect those agents would be used for?

The U.S. used the existence of Iraqi nerve gas -- weapons, let me repeat,
that were shipped to Iraq by the U.S. and its allies, primarily Britain,
France and Germany -- as a basis for vilifying Iraq. This enabled the U.S.
government to get away with atrocity after atrocity in a war more properly
called the "Gulf Massacre." Civilian casualties? No problem. They're just
"collateral damage."(3)

Most people assume that if any nerve gas had been used it would have had to
have been Saddam's doing. No corporate paper or tv newscast has yet dared
suggest the possibility that it was the U.S., not Saddam, that used
dangerous biological and chemical warfare agents in the Gulf.

That thought remains beyond the pale even today, despite the U.S.'s long
history of biological and chemical warfare and experimentation on human
beings.(4) Saddam, after all, was portrayed as the war criminal, "worse than
Hitler,. The problem is that George Bush fit that description as well.

On September 11th 1990, U.S. President George Bush, upholding "democracy"
and "peace," declared his "New World Order". He was soon to order thousands
of tons of napalm, air fuel explosives, phosphorous bombs, cluster bombs,
and uranium encased shells, raining holy terror upon Iraq. Seven Years
later, President Clinton did George Bush one better -- he actually signed a
top secret directive authorizing first use of nuclear weapons against Iraq
"under certain circumstances."

By the end of February, 1998, two Los Angeles class submarines carrying
nuclear warheads atop Tomahawk missiles had arrived in the Gulf. Each
missile is encased in so called "depleted" uranium.(5) The non nuclear
version, also enclosed in depleted uranium, are now being used against
Afghanistan. The foxes of imperialism and world domination use every trick
in the book to guard and to expand their multi trillion dollar oil henhouse.
